A reversible high-efficiency amplifier/rectifier circuit using one transistor has been proposed. For the gate side of the transistor, an input circuit for the amplifier and a gate adjusting circuit for the rectifier are prepared. By switching the circuits, the operation mode is changed. Microwave power transfer has been evaluated at 2.45GHz by using a high-efficiency InGaAs/GaAs pHEMT amplifier and rectifier. The same type of HEMT and harmonic treatment circuit were used for both the amplifier and the rectifier.
